Kohl Miner is a poet, playwright, performer and native of the Ho-Chunk Nation. After long stints in New York and Los Angeles over the past 16 years, Miner returned to Minneapolis earlier this year and hasn’t skipped a beat in his creative life. 3-Minute Egg catches up with Miner through the Equilibrium spoken word series at The Loft Literary Center.
